Village Overview

Keotapatti is a village in Kishanpur Block,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Supaul district, Bihar. For Keotapatti, the population is 1,954, PIN code is 852138 and Census village code is 221224. Location and Administration

Keotapatti comes under Kathara_kadampura gram panchayat and Kishanpur C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Kishanpur Block,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The block headquarters is Kishanpur at 1 km. The Census district headquarters, Supaul, is 17 km away.

Agriculture and Land Use

Land-use area is reported in hectares using Census village directory land-use categories such as net area sown, irrigated area, forest, fallow land and non-agricultural use. This is useful for general village research, farming context and local area study.

Agriculture and land-use records for Keotapatti
Net area sown128 hectares
Irrigated area125 hectares
Unirrigated area3 hectares
Canal irrigated area85 hectares
Wells / tube wells irrigated area40 hectares
Non-agricultural area9 hectares
Main cropPaddy
Second cropWheat
